オブジェクト指向システムの設計 172at TECHオブジェクト指向システムの設計 172 - 暇つぶし2ch■コピペモード□スレを通常表示□オプションモード□このスレッドのURL■項目テキスト50:デフォルトの名無しさん 16/07/12 02:21:04.05 umCvEWis.net >>47,48 情報ありがとう。頭だけざっくり読んだけど、詳細検討には時間がかかりそうだ。 googleのコーディングガイドでしれっと最後に > Windowsのコードについては、このルールは例外です(シャレでなく)。 とあるのだが、Windowsで閉じている場合は環境が整備されているから googleみたいな運用方法でも障害にはならないということなのかな? 大ジャンプが問題になっているけど、 現実的には大ジャンプ無しでの処理を強制するのなら例外を使う意味は無いよね。 例えば>>17なら従来方式、 int result = Director.Create("C:\\testdir"); if (result==1) MessageBox.Show("入出力エラーが発生しました。"); else if (result==2) MessageBox.Show("想定外のエラーが発生しました。"); でもほぼ同じなわけでさ。当然そのMSのサンプルコードもthrowしている。 その点>>15の方がそのMSのサンプルコードには似ている。 とはいえthrowするなってのは環境的な問題もあるとは思うんだが。 次ページ最新レス表示レスジャンプ類似スレ一覧スレッドの検索話題のニュースおまかせリストオプションしおりを挟むスレッドに書込スレッドの一覧暇つぶし2ch